Chipotle Guacamole Burger Patty
with smoky paprika sweet potato fries
This burger features a favorite combination among our team and community - spicy chipotle and creamy guacamole. Sweet potato fries on the side make this a classic warm weather meal that was last featured in 2019.
Ingredients
- Chipotle peppers - 1, chopped (usually found in adobo sauce)
- Cilantro leaves - 2 Tbsp, chopped
- Beef, ground - 1 1/2 lbs
- Bragg's / coconut aminos - 2 tsp
- Salt - 1/2 tsp
- Black pepper - 1/4 tsp
- Guacamole (ingredients listed separately) - for serving
- Shallots - 1 clove, chopped
- Cilantro leaves - 1 Tbsp, chopped
- Avocados - 1
- Lime juice - 2 tsp
- Sweet potatoes - 1 lb, sliced into fries
- Oil, cooking - 1 Tbsp
- Paprika, smoked - 2 tsp
- Dipping sauces of choice (opt) - for serving

Prep
-
Sweet potatoes - (If prepping right before cooking, get grill / oven heating before continuing with prep.) Slice into fries. (Can be done up to 5 days ahead)
-
Chipotles / Shallots / Cilantro (for burgers and guacamole) - Prep as directed. Combine chipotles and cilantro for burgers in one container. Combine shallots and cilantro for guacamole in another container. (Can be done up to 3 days ahead)
-
Make burger patties - Mix together beef, aminos, salt, pepper, chipotles, and cilantro (portion for burgers). Form into 1” / 2.5 cm thick patties and make a depression in the center with your thumb (this will help the patties to retain an even thickness as they cook). (Can be done 1 day ahead)
-
Make guacamole - Mash together avocados, shallots, cilantro (portion for guacamole), and lime juice. Season with some salt. Add some hot sauce (not on ingredients list) if you’d like it to be spicy.

Make
-
Heat oven to 425F / 218C degrees. Spread sweet potatoes out on a sheet pan. Toss with oil and smoked paprika. Season with some salt. Roast for 20 to 30 minutes (depending on thickness), shaking the pan halfway through cooking.
-
If cooking on a grill: Heat grill to 450F / 232C degrees. Clean grates and brush with some oil.
-
{grill}: While sweet potato fries bake, place burger patties on grill and grill on one side until grill marks appear, 2 to 3 minutes. Flip burgers and continue cooking until cooked to your liking - 2 to 3 minutes more for medium-rare, 3 to 4 minutes more for medium, 5 to 6 minutes more for well-done.
-
If cooking on the stovetop: While sweet potato fries bake, heat up a grill pan or skillet over high heat. Brush with some oil. Add burger patties to heated pan and cook on one side until grill marks appear, 2 to 3 minutes. Flip burgers and continue cooking until cooked to your liking - 2 to 3 minutes more for medium-rare, 3 to 4 minutes more for medium, 5 to 6 minutes more for well-done.
-
Enjoy burger patties topped with guacamole. Serve sweet potato fries on the side with dipping sauce if you’d like.
